Aprender cómo deshacer la última acción de la interfaz de usuario de la aplicación de Office Excel puede hacer su aplicación más robusta al no permitir al usuario escribir sobre la información importante en su hoja de trabajo. Puede utilizar Visual Basic para Aplicaciones ( VBA) para automatizar procesos como deshacer una acción. VBA se puede utilizar en todas las aplicaciones de Microsoft Office para automatizar tareas que puede llevar mucho tiempo si se hace manualmente . Usted puede utilizar el método " Application.Undo " en Excel para cancelar la última acción realizada por el usuario. Instrucciones
1
lanzamiento de Microsoft Office Excel , haga clic en la pestaña de " desarrolladores" y tipo "deshacer " en " B1 ". Haga clic en " Visual Basic " para iniciar la ventana del editor de VBA.
2
Crear un nuevo procedimiento escribiendo el siguiente texto :
undoBOneText Sub Private ()
3
Copia y pega el siguiente código para deshacer el texto que ha escrito en "B1 " y sustituirla por " Introducir texto " de la siguiente manera : . .
Application.EnableEvents = False.Undo.EnableEvents = TrueEnd WithRange ( "B1 ") SelectRange ( "B1 " ) Valor = "Introduzca texto: " End Sub
4
Press "F5 " para ejecutar el procedimiento
.